March 2024 EMD Newsletter / Issue 23 / It’s not luck, it’s planning. /  During March, LA City Emergency Management encourages you to integrate pets into preparedness plans and practice flood and tsunami safety. / Flooding is an overflow of water onto normally dry land. Floods are the most common disaster in the U.S. Failing to evacuate flooded areas or entering flood waters can lead to injury or death. DO NOT walk, swim or drive through them. Turn Around. Don’t  Drown!
